The ProLinx family Allen Bradley Remote I/O Adapter to PROFIBUS DPV1 Master communications module (5604-RIO-PDPMV1) creates a powerful connection between devices on a Remote I/O network and PROFIBUS slave devices. The module is a stand-alone DIN-rail mounted protocol gateway that provides one Remote I/O port and a PROFIBUS DPV1 Master with a RS-485 9-pin D shell female connector interface with isolated Opto-Couplers. The RIO interface is an adapter (slave) which can be connected to a RIO scanner (master) that controls the data transfer. The PROFIBUS DPV1 Master (PDPMV1) protocol driver supports Master implementations of the protocol on either a Mono-Master or Multi-Master network. The DPV1 master supports FDT/DTM communication when using the PSW-cDTM-PDPM FDT communication DTM. The PROFIBUS DPV1 Master FDT communication DTM software is an interface between any compliant FDT software container, an FDT device DTM and applicable PROFIBUS slave devices. The ProLinx Communication Modules provide connectivity for two or more dissimilar network types. The modules, encased in sturdy extruded aluminum, are stand-alone DIN-rail mounted protocol gateways, providing communication between many of the most widely used protocols in the industrial automation today.
